Election Duty absenteeism to be strictly dealt with- District Electoral Officer Girish Dayalan

Departmental and penal action to be taken against the absentees; Attempts to exert undue pressure on Returning Officer's would invite strict action

National Punjab Press-Release

SAS Nagar, February 8: In the democratic setup conduct of free and fair elections is one of the most important duties of the administration; an officer or official showing callousness towards the job or willful absenteeism from duty will be strictly dealt with said District Electoral Officer Girish Dayalan in a meeting held here today to review the poll preparedness for the forthcoming elections to the Civic bodies.

The unanimous report from all the Returning Officers that quite a few of the staff deployed on poll duty under one pretext or the other try to evade duty; in some cases external pressure to cancel duty is also being exerted , invited wrath of the DEO and he made it crystal clear that any attempts at outside influence would be viewed as obstructing the process of elections and serious action would be taken in such cases.

He said that in case of absenteeism from duty would, administration would write against the erring officer/official to the respective Department’s Administrative Secretaries for strict departmental and penal action as the need be as well as to the State election for action under relevant sections of Representation of the People Act (RP Act) 1951 and Punjab State Election ACT,1994.
